Chicken Feet and Head Soup Recipe

Ingredients:

  • 500 grams chicken feet (with head)
  • 2 carrots
  • 2 potatoes
  • 1/4 cabbage
  • Spices:
    • 4 cloves garlic
    • 3 shallots
    • 1 stalk green onion (scallion)
    • 1 teaspoon ground black pepper
    • Salt to taste
    • Seasoning to taste
  • Water

Instructions:

  1. Prepare the Chicken Feet:
    Begin by thoroughly cleaning the chicken feet and heads. Place them into a large pot filled with water. Bring to a boil and cook until the chicken feet become tender.

  2. Prepare the Vegetables:
    While the chicken feet are cooking, peel and cut the carrots and potatoes into your desired shapes. Chop the cabbage into bite-sized pieces. Rinse all the vegetables under cold water and set them aside.

  3. Sauté the Aromatics:
    In a separate pan, finely mince the garlic and shallots. Slice the green onion (scallion) into thin rings. Heat a small amount of oil in the pan and sauté the minced garlic, shallots, and green onion until they release a fragrant aroma.

  4. Combine Ingredients:
    Add the chopped vegetables to the pan with the sautéed aromatics. Stir well to combine. Pour in enough water to cover the vegetables and bring the mixture to a gentle simmer.

  5. Add Chicken Feet and Seasonings:
    Once the chicken feet have softened, transfer them from the pot to the pan with the vegetables. Sprinkle in the ground black pepper, salt, and seasoning to taste. Stir everything together and let it simmer until the vegetables are fully cooked and tender.

  6. Serve:
    Once the vegetables are tender and the flavors are well melded, remove the soup from heat. Serve hot, and enjoy the comforting, savory goodness of this traditional soup.
